About the role
The Youth Drop-in Center Coordinator will coordinate and implement all services provided at the SAFY Youth Drop-In Center in Lima BH division. The position involves coordinating programs, implementing activities, assisting with referrals, and collaborating with various stakeholders.
Responsibilities
- Coordinate and implement all Drop-In Center services (including program orientation, peer participant groups, education sessions, group activities, recreational programming, adult mentoring, community involvement, and aftercare planning).
- Aid in case-related activities for youth visiting the Drop-In Center.
- Assist in obtaining direct services for youth from their community of origin.
- Involvement in family and individual sessions to support positive change.
- Assist with distribution of PR packets and promoting the Drop-In Center.
- Meet with schools, social services agencies, and the business community for PR purposes.
- Engage in outreach to youth participating in Drop-In Center services.
- Participate in joint meetings, problem identification, and resolution.
- Establish and maintain a supportive and positive working relationship with youth, foster parents, referring agencies, and other SAFY stakeholders.
- Mandated reporting and monitoring of all documentation and activities.
- Model and coach staff.
- Prepare monthly schedules for staff at the Drop-In Center.
- Attend relevant seminars, training, conferences, and workshops to enhance professional skills.
- Participate in meetings and committees as required.
- Conduct new staff orientation training as needed.
